What is a prefix number?

A telephone prefix is the first set of digits after the country, and area codes of a telephone number; in the North American Numbering Plan countries (country code +# ), it is the first three digits of a seven-digit phone number, 3-3-4 scheme. It shows which exchange the remaining numbers refer to.

Where is 463 prefix?

Indianapolis
Area codes 317 and 463 are North American Numbering Plan area codes for Indianapolis and nine surrounding counties in central Indiana. It covers all or part of Marion, Boone, Hancock, Hamilton, Hendricks, Johnson, Madison, Morgan, and Shelby counties.

When was the 248 area code created?

1997
The rest of Wayne County, including Detroit, located to the southeast, is serviced by area code 313. Area code 248 was created in 1997 as a split from area code 810. In 2000, area code 947 was assigned as a relief area code for the area.

What area code is 248 cover?

Area codes 248 and 947 are area codes in the North American Numbering Plan (NANP) for Oakland County in the U.S. state of Michigan. The area codes also serve portions of Livonia and Northville, both located in Wayne County.

What are the toll free prefixes?

Toll free codes – 800, 888, 877, 866, 855, 844 and 833. Toll free numbers are numbers that begin with one of the following three-digit codes: 800, 888, 877, 866, 855, 844 or 833. Although 800, 888, 877, 866, 855, 844 and 833 are all toll free codes, they are not interchangeable.
